Property Description

Investment Property Realty Group (IPRG) is pleased to introduce 120 Forsyth Street, a 22 unit mixed use building located between Delancey Street and Broome Street in the heart of Manhattan’s Lower East Side.

Rising five stories, the property comprises 18 residential apartments and 4 retail storefronts. Of the 18 apartments, all units are one bedroom rent stabilized apartments.

The building measures 25 ft by 79 ft, sits on a 25.67 ft by 100.25 ft lot, and is 9,618 SF, and is zoned C4 4A / R7A equivalent. The property is positioned within walking distance of major subway lines: the nearest station is the Bowery Station serviced by the J, Z lines. Additional nearby access includes the Grand Street Station (B, D lines) and the Delancey Street–Essex Street Station (J, M, Z and F lines), offering tenants and owners effortless connectivity to all corners of Manhattan and beyond.
